Blockchain Jobs: A Comprehensive Guide

The blockchain is more than just the technology behind cryptocurrencies; it’s a revolutionary force reshaping industries and creating a surge in blockchain jobs . If you’re seeking a career that’s both cutting-edge and in high demand, then exploring the world of blockchain careers might be your next best move. This guide provides a comprehensive look at the blockchain job market , the diverse roles available, the skills you need to succeed, and how to break into this exciting field.

Table of Contents

Decoding the Blockchain Job Market

The blockchain job market is booming, driven by the increasing adoption of blockchain technology across various sectors. This section will explore the fundamentals of blockchain and why it’s generating so many employment opportunities.

What Exactly is Blockchain Technology?

At its core, a blockchain is a distributed, decentralized, public ledger. Think of it as a digital record book that’s shared among many computers. Each “block” in the chain contains a batch of transactions, and once a block is added to the chain, it cannot be altered. This immutability and transparency are key features that make blockchain so secure and valuable. It’s used to record not just financial transactions, but also supply chain data, medical records, and much more.

The Booming Demand for Blockchain Professionals

The demand for skilled blockchain professionals is outpacing the supply, creating a significant opportunity for those with the right skills and knowledge. Companies are investing heavily in blockchain technology, leading to a surge in demand for developers, engineers, consultants, and other specialists. This demand is fueled by the potential of blockchain to improve efficiency, security, and transparency in a wide range of industries.

What Blockchain Roles Are Out There?

The beauty of the blockchain industry is its diversity. From developers to lawyers, there’s a role for almost every skill set. Let’s explore some of the most in-demand blockchain roles :

Blockchain Developer: The Core Builder

blockchain developer is the backbone of any blockchain project. They are responsible for designing, developing, and implementing blockchain solutions.

  • Writing smart contracts
  • Developing decentralized applications (dApps)
  • Working with cryptographic protocols
  • Integrating blockchain with other systems

Blockchain Engineer: Architecting the System

blockchain engineer takes a broader view, focusing on the overall architecture and infrastructure of blockchain systems. They are responsible for:

  • Designing and implementing blockchain networks
  • Ensuring the scalability and security of blockchain solutions
  • Managing blockchain nodes and infrastructure
  • Troubleshooting technical issues

Blockchain Architect: Designing the Future

blockchain architect is a visionary, responsible for designing the overall blueprint for blockchain solutions. They need to:

  • Understand business requirements and translate them into technical solutions
  • Evaluate different blockchain platforms and choose the right one
  • Design secure and scalable blockchain architectures
  • Stay up-to-date with the latest blockchain trends

Blockchain Consultant: Guiding the Way

blockchain consultant advises organizations on how to leverage blockchain technology to improve their business processes. They will:

  • Assess business needs and identify opportunities for blockchain adoption
  • Develop blockchain strategies and roadmaps
  • Provide technical guidance and support
  • Educate clients on blockchain technology

Blockchain Project Manager: Orchestrating Success

blockchain project manager is responsible for overseeing the successful execution of blockchain projects. Their duties include:

  • Planning and managing project timelines and budgets
  • Coordinating development teams
  • Ensuring project deliverables are met
  • Managing stakeholder expectations

Blockchain Analyst: Uncovering Insights

blockchain analyst dives deep into blockchain data to extract valuable insights. They will:

  • Analyze blockchain transactions and identify trends
  • Develop risk management strategies
  • Monitor blockchain network activity
  • Prepare reports and presentations

blockchain lawyer specializes in the legal and regulatory aspects of blockchain technology. They handle matters like:

  • Advising on regulatory compliance
  • Drafting smart contract agreements
  • Protecting intellectual property
  • Representing clients in blockchain-related disputes

Blockchain Marketing Specialist: Spreading the Word

blockchain marketing specialist focuses on promoting blockchain-based products and services. They are responsible for:

  • Developing marketing campaigns
  • Creating content about blockchain technology
  • Managing social media presence
  • Attracting new users to blockchain platforms

What Skills Do You Need for Blockchain Jobs?

To land your dream blockchain job , you’ll need a combination of technical and soft skills.

Technical Skills: The Foundation

The specific technical skills you need will depend on the role you’re targeting, but here are some essential areas to focus on:

Programming Languages: Solidity, JavaScript, Python, Go

Understanding various programming languages is crucial.

  • Solidity : The primary language for writing smart contracts on Ethereum.
  • JavaScript : Used for building front-end and back-end components of dApps.
  • Python : A versatile language used for data analysis, scripting, and blockchain development.
  • Go : A powerful language used for building high-performance blockchain applications.

Cryptography: Securing the System

Blockchain’s security relies heavily on cryptography. You should understand:

  • Hashing algorithms
  • Digital signatures
  • Encryption techniques
  • Public-key infrastructure (PKI)

Smart Contracts: Automating Agreements

Smart contracts are self-executing agreements written in code. You should know:

  • How to write, deploy, and test smart contracts
  • Smart contract security best practices
  • Different smart contract platforms (e.g., Ethereum, Solana, Cardano)

Data Structures and Algorithms: Optimizing Performance

Understanding data structures and algorithms is crucial for optimizing the performance of blockchain applications.

  • Linked lists
  • Trees
  • Graphs
  • Sorting and searching algorithms

Consensus Mechanisms: Ensuring Agreement

You should have a solid understanding of how different consensus mechanisms work. Examples include:

  • Proof-of-Work (PoW)
  • Proof-of-Stake (PoS)
  • Delegated Proof-of-Stake (DPoS)

Soft Skills: The Differentiator

Technical skills are important, but soft skills can set you apart.

Communication: Bridging the Gap

Being able to communicate effectively is crucial for explaining complex technical concepts to non-technical audiences.

Problem-Solving: Tackling Challenges

Blockchain projects often involve complex challenges. You need to be able to think critically and find creative solutions.

Teamwork: Collaborating Effectively

Most blockchain projects require teamwork. You need to be able to collaborate effectively with other developers, engineers, and stakeholders.

Adaptability: Embracing Change

The blockchain space is constantly evolving. You need to be able to adapt to new technologies and trends.

The blockchain job outlook is extremely promising, with demand expected to continue growing in the coming years. Let’s look at some key trends:

Industries Hiring Blockchain Professionals

Blockchain technology is being adopted across a wide range of industries, including:

  • Finance : Improving payment systems, streamlining trade finance, and combating fraud.
  • Supply Chain : Tracking goods, verifying authenticity, and enhancing transparency.
  • Healthcare : Securing medical records, improving data interoperability, and streamlining clinical trials.
  • Gaming : Creating new gaming experiences, enabling in-game asset ownership, and fostering decentralized gaming communities.

Salary Expectations: What You Can Earn

Blockchain salaries are highly competitive, reflecting the high demand for skilled professionals. Here’s a general idea of what you can expect to earn (note that these figures can vary depending on experience, location, and company):

RoleAverage Salary (USD)
Blockchain Developer$120,000 – $170,000
Blockchain Engineer$130,000 – $180,000
Blockchain Architect$150,000 – $200,000+
Blockchain Consultant$120,000 – $180,000+
Blockchain Project Manager$110,000 – $160,000
Blockchain Analyst$90,000 – $140,000

Breaking into the Blockchain Industry: A Step-by-Step Guide

Breaking into the blockchain industry can seem daunting, but with the right approach, it’s definitely achievable.

Education and Training: Building Your Knowledge Base

  • Online Courses : Platforms like Coursera, Udemy, and edX offer a wide range of blockchain courses.
  • Bootcamps : Immersive programs that provide intensive training in blockchain development.
  • Certifications : Earning certifications like the Certified Blockchain Professional (CBP) can demonstrate your knowledge and skills.

Networking: Connecting with the Community

  • Attend blockchain conferences and meetups .
  • Join online communities and forums .
  • Connect with blockchain professionals on LinkedIn .
  • Contribute to open-source blockchain projects .

Building a Portfolio: Showcasing Your Skills

  • Create a portfolio of blockchain projects .
  • Contribute to open-source projects .
  • Participate in hackathons .
  • Write blog posts or articles about blockchain technology .

Job Searching: Where to Find Opportunities

  • Use online job boards like LinkedIn, Indeed, and CryptoJobsList.
  • Network with people in the blockchain industry .
  • Tailor your resume and cover letter to each job application .
  • Prepare for technical interviews .

While the blockchain industry offers incredible opportunities, it’s important to be aware of the challenges.

The Skills Gap: Addressing the Shortage

There’s a significant shortage of skilled blockchain professionals. This means you’ll need to invest in your education and training to stand out from the crowd.

Regulatory Uncertainty: Staying Informed

The regulatory landscape for blockchain is still evolving. It’s important to stay informed about the latest regulations in your jurisdiction.

Security Risks: Mitigating Threats

Blockchain systems can be vulnerable to security threats. You need to understand security best practices and take steps to mitigate risks.

The Decentralized Horizon: How Blockchain Jobs Will Evolve

The blockchain industry is constantly evolving, and the opportunities will only continue to grow.

The Rise of Web3: A New Era of Opportunity

Web3, the decentralized web, is built on blockchain technology. This new era of the internet will create even more opportunities for blockchain professionals.

The Convergence of Blockchain and Other Technologies

Blockchain is converging with other technologies like AI, IoT, and cloud computing. This convergence will create new and innovative applications.

The Expanding Scope of Blockchain Applications

Blockchain is being used in more and more industries, from finance and supply chain to healthcare and gaming. This expanding scope of applications will drive demand for blockchain professionals.

Your Blockchain Journey Starts Now

The world of blockchain jobs is ripe with opportunity. By understanding the technology, developing the right skills, and building your network, you can carve out a successful and rewarding career in this innovative field. It’s time to start exploring the decentralized horizon.

For a deeper dive into blockchain technology and its various applications, consider exploring reputable resources such as the official Ethereum documentation .

Leave a Comment